Skip to content

Preload button mask images (invisible retry button) #22912

@dbkr

Description

@dbkr

Steps to reproduce

  1. Load element in browser
  2. Go to room
  3. Unplug Internet
  4. Type a message & press enter
  5. Wait for red '!' to appear by the message
  6. Hover over message to get the action bar

Outcome

What did you expect?

An action bar with some action button, including retry

What happened instead?

Action bar with some or all buttons blank
Screenshot 2022-07-21 at 18 24 41
Screenshot 2022-07-21 at 18 24 49

We rely on loading the mask images for the buttons on-demand, which is particularly unfortunate for the retry button which tends to appear when you have no Internet.

Operating system

No response

Browser information

No response

URL for webapp

No response

Application version

No response

Homeserver

No response

Will you send logs?

No

Metadata

Metadata

Labels

Type

No type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ions